Lufthansa’s 24-hour strike strands 220,000 passengers; Austrians urged to reroute via Vienna or rail
A 24-hour pilot and cabin-crew strike grounded most Lufthansa flights on 12 February, spilling over to Austrian travellers who rely on Frankfurt and Munich connections. Vienna flights remained operational but were quickly overbooked; rail and alternative hubs became the only viable options. Employers should trigger back-up routing plans and remind staff of EU 261 compensation.
